Course summary

This course aims to consolidate and extend students' understanding of Chemistry. The examination board for this course is AQA. Students study a wide range of both Physical, Organic and Inorganic Chemistry including atoms and bonding, energy, equilibria, transition metals and organic analysis.

Entry requirements

At least five 9-5 grades at GCSE level. This should include 6s in English Language and Mathematics and Combined or Triple Science.

How you'll be assessed

Students are assessed at the end of the two years and will sit through three written examinations. Paper 1 is worth 35%, Paper 2 is worth 35% Paper 3 is worth 30%. Students are also assessed throughout the year on various key practical competencies - a number of which will also come up in each of the exams
